Signs Your System Needs an Upgrade 🕵️
Not all solar systems age gracefully. Here’s how to spot when your setup might be holding you back:
- Dwindling Output: Are your energy bills creeping up, even though your habits haven’t changed? Older panels and inverters lose efficiency over time—sometimes up to 20% or more after 10–15 years.
- Frequent Repairs: Do you find yourself calling for fixes more than you’d like? Repeated inverter failures, broken panels, or worn-out wiring are red flags.
- Outdated Equipment: Many homes still run on older string inverters or panels that can’t keep up with today’s standards. If your inverter hums like a fridge or your system lacks monitoring, it’s likely time.
- No Battery Backup: If you’re still fully grid-dependent, you’re missing out on the resilience and savings of modern battery storage.
- Limited Monitoring: Can you see how much your system produces, or is it a guessing game? Today’s systems offer smartphone apps and real-time data.
- Expired Warranties: Most panel warranties last 20–25 years, but inverters and batteries may be out of coverage much sooner.
- Roof Work Needed: Planning to replace your roof? It’s a prime time to assess your solar array and upgrade.

Benefits of Modern Panels and Inverters
It’s like trading in your old flip phone for a smartphone. Modern solar tech brings big advantages:
- Higher Efficiency: New panels convert more sunlight into power, so you get more electricity from the same roof space.
- Better Durability: Today’s panels withstand harsher weather and have longer lifespans.
- Smaller Footprint: Fewer, higher-output panels mean less roof coverage for the same power.
- Improved Safety: Modern inverters and rapid shutdown devices meet the latest National Electrical Code (NEC) standards, reducing fire risk.
- Smarter Inverters: Microinverters and optimizers mean each panel works independently—so shade or dirt on one doesn’t drag down the whole system.
- Longer Warranties: Many new panels offer warranties up to 30 years.

Cost and ROI of Upgrades
Upgrades aren’t just about spending—they’re about investing in a brighter, more reliable future.
- Panel Upgrades: Expect costs to vary widely by system size, roof type, and panel quality. Most homeowners see payback in 5–10 years, sometimes less with incentives.
- Inverter Replacement: Older inverters are often the first point of failure. Modern replacements can boost output and reliability.
- Battery Storage: Prices have dropped, but batteries are still a significant investment. Incentives (like the federal solar tax credit) can reduce out-of-pocket costs.
- ROI Factors: Savings depend on local energy rates, how much sun your roof gets, and your home’s usage patterns.

How to Choose the Right Upgrades
Solar isn’t one-size-fits-all. Here’s how to map the right path for your home:
- Assess Your Needs: Are you after lower bills, more backup power, or better monitoring?
- Check Compatibility: Some older systems can be partially upgraded; others need a full overhaul.
- Consider Roof Age: If your roof is nearing replacement, coordinate solar upgrades for less hassle and cost.
- Review Incentives: Federal, state, and local rebates can make upgrades more affordable. The U.S. Department of Energy’s Database of State Incentives for Renewables & Efficiency (DSIRE) is a good resource.
- Think Long-Term: Choose panels and batteries with strong warranties and proven performance records.

What to Expect During the Process 🛠️
Here’s a step-by-step look at a typical solar upgrade:
- Site Assessment: A technician examines your current system, roof, and electrical setup.
- Design Proposal: You’ll get options for panels, inverters, batteries, or other upgrades—plus costs and timelines.
- Permitting: The installer handles paperwork with your local building department.
- Installation: Old equipment is removed and new components are installed. For panel upgrades, expect some roof work.
- Inspection: Your city or county inspects the system for code compliance.
- Activation: System is tested and switched back on. You’ll be shown how to use new monitoring tools.
- Follow-up: Warranties and documentation are provided, and you’ll have support for future questions.

Frequently Asked Questions
How do I know if my solar system is underperforming?
Compare your recent energy bills to when the system was new. If output drops more than 10–15% without a clear reason, it’s time for a checkup.
Will upgrading void my old warranties?
Upgrading with a professional installer often extends or renews warranties. DIY changes can put coverage at risk.
Are there financing options for solar upgrades?
Yes—“Solar Financing Options near you” may include loans, leases, or power purchase agreements. Ask about local and federal incentives.
Can I add a battery to my existing solar system?
In most cases, yes. Compatibility depends on your current inverter and system design. A site assessment will clarify your options.
